Aleut vs Hawaiian Receiving Food Stamps Correlation Chart
The statistical analysis conducted on geographies consisting of 61,758,558 people shows a mild positive correlation between the proportion of Aleuts and percentage of population receiving government assistance and/or food stamps in the United States with a correlation coefficient (R) of 0.369 and weighted average of 12.4%. Similarly, the statistical analysis conducted on geographies consisting of 327,058,596 people shows a substantial positive correlation between the proportion of Hawaiians and percentage of population receiving government assistance and/or food stamps in the United States with a correlation coefficient (R) of 0.522 and weighted average of 12.9%, a difference of 4.3%.
